Whether you are performing fleet maintenance for your own fleet or service to fleet customers, it is necessary to maintain wheel alignment angles to save on struts, suspension and tire wear. Using QuickTrick alignment kits is an excellent way of maintaining alignment and suspension for a more comfortable, safer, and smoother ride.

When the wheels of your commercial vehicles are properly maintained, it will lead to increased efficiency, lower costs, and enhanced driver safety.

 Why do you need to carry out regular fleet maintenance activities?

You have to perform routine fleet maintenance tasks to avert or handle the following issues:

  • Collision damage
  • Potholes and uneven roads
  • Steering discomfort or improper driving
  • Irregular tire wear
  • Excessive fuel costs

If you fail to perform preventative maintenance schedules you will have issues with the wheel alignment that will lead to excessive down time, driver fatigue and added fuel costs.
